Norman Park is a city in Colquitt County, in the Moultrie metro area.
The community was named for J.B. Norman, who established a college here.
The latitude of Norman Park is 31.268N. The longitude is -83.687W.
It is in the Eastern Standard time zone. Elevation is 335 feet.The estimated population, in 2003, was 862.

At the time of the 2000 census, the per capita income in Norman Park was $13,421, compared with $21,587 nationally.
16% of Norman Park residents age 25 and older have a bachelor's or advanced college degree.
Median rent in Norman Park, at the time of the 2000 Census, was $288. Monthly homeowner costs, for people with mortgages, were $632.

The average commute time for Norman Park workers is 25 minutes, compared with 26 minutes nationwide.
